The FRN0009G2S-4GU: The 9 A output current and 5 hp rating define the motor frame size this drive can handle — a standard 5 hp IEC or NEMA motor on a 400 V class supply. The 380-480 VAC input range with +10%/-15% tolerance covers nominal 400 V and 460 V grids without a transformer. Output frequency spans 0.1 to 120 Hz, which covers most fixed-speed to moderate-speed fan/pump applications. The NEMA 1 enclosure is suitable for indoor, non-condensing environments; the open-style chassis means it is intended for panel mounting, not standalone wall mount.
This drive carries a lifecycle stage of current, meaning Fuji Electric continues to manufacture it. No last-time-buy or phase-out notice applies.
I/O and control interface
The drive provides 7 digital inputs and 3 analog inputs, plus 5 digital outputs and 2 analog outputs. It accepts remote contact closure for start/stop and supports keypad or remote control. The LCD/LED display shows motor speed with percent, alarm codes, menus, and function codes; a separate digital readout cycles through output frequency, current, and voltage. Dynamic braking is built in, though no internal brake chopper is included — an external braking resistor is needed for overhauling loads.
Protection and compliance
Protection circuits cover drive thermal overload, motor thermal overload, overvoltage, undervoltage, phase failure, phase-to-phase and phase-to-ground short circuit, and over-braking. The drive is listed to UL508C, CSA C22.2 No.14, and EN50178-1997, covering North American and European safety standards for industrial control equipment.
